Instructions
In a bowl, cream butter and sugar.
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Stir in extract. Sift together flour, cardamom and soda; add alternately with sour cream to creamed mixture. Fold in almonds. Divide dough into six parts; shape into rolls (like refrigerated cookie dough).
Place three each on two greased baking sheets.
Bake at 350° for about 30 minutes or until light brown.
Remove rolls to cutting board. Using a sharp knife, slice rolls diagonally 1/2 in. thick.
Place cookies on sheets; return to oven and bake until light brown. Cool; store in tightly covered containers.
